Image Flavors
Every release publishes two flavors of the same rift binary. They are interchangeable — same admin API, same imposter behaviour, same ports, same environment variables.
| Tag | Base | Use it when |
|---|---|---|
latest, X.Y.Z | debian:trixie-slim | The default. |
latest-static, X.Y.Z-static | scratch | You want the smallest CVE surface — typically ephemeral CI/test environments. |
docker pull zainalpour/rift-proxy:latest-static
docker run -p 2525:2525 zainalpour/rift-proxy:latest-static
The -static flavor is a statically-linked musl build on FROM scratch. It contains the rift binary, a CA certificate bundle, and a passwd entry — nothing else. No package manager ever runs in it, so an image scanner finds no OS packages to report: there is no base distro to keep patching just because rift is running in your test suite.
Two consequences worth knowing before you switch:
- No shell. There is no
/bin/sh, sodocker exec ... sh, string-formcommand:overrides, and shell-form healthchecks do not work. Use exec form (["rift", "healthcheck"]) and pass flags directly. The health probe is built into the binary precisely for this reason — seerift healthcheck. - No mimalloc. The musl binaries are built without the mimalloc allocator (it is a default feature of the glibc builds). Scripting and the Redis backend are both present. If you are benchmarking allocation-heavy workloads, use the default flavor.
HTTPS upstream proxying works in both: the CA bundle is copied into the static image, because rift’s TLS client loads the OS trust store at runtime.
Verifying an Image
Published images carry an SBOM and max-mode provenance, and are signed with cosign keyless — the signing identity is the release workflow itself, so there is no public key to distribute.
# Verify the signature and its provenance
cosign verify \
--certificate-identity-regexp 'https://github.com/achird-labs/rift/.github/workflows/.+' \
--certificate-oidc-issuer https://token.actions.githubusercontent.com \
zainalpour/rift-proxy:latest-static
# Inspect the SBOM / provenance attestations
docker buildx imagetools inspect zainalpour/rift-proxy:latest-static \
--format ''
docker buildx imagetools inspect zainalpour/rift-proxy:latest-static \
--format ''

Feature flags for a custom build
crates/rift-http-proxy/Dockerfile builds with ARG FEATURES=javascript,redis-backend by default. If you’re building a slimmer image (or embedding Rift as a cdylib instead of running the container), see the Cargo feature table in FFI (C-ABI) and the Embedding & SPI overview — the same features gate both the binary and the rift-ffi cdylib, and cargo build --no-default-features (plus an explicit --features list) drops the scripting engines and Redis backend you don’t need.

Drive the Admin API
The images ship the rift binary and nothing else — no curl, and in the -static flavor no shell either — so run these from the host against the published admin port rather than via docker exec.
# Create imposter
curl -X POST http://localhost:2525/imposters \
-H "Content-Type: application/json" \
-d '{"port": 4545, "protocol": "http", "stubs": []}'
# List imposters
curl http://localhost:2525/imposters
The one thing worth running inside the container is the health probe, which is built in:
docker exec rift rift healthcheck && echo healthy
